Taxonomic Classification

Rank Agile antechinus Bi-Coloured Skipper
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Dasyuromorphia (Dasyuromorphia)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Dasyuridae Hesperiidae
Genus Antechinus Abantis
Species Antechinus agilis Abantis bicolor
